2006 Audi A6 vs. 2008 Honda HR-V
To start off, 2008 Honda HR-V is newer by 2 year(s). Which means there will be less support and parts availability for 2006 Audi A6. In addition, the cost of maintenance, including insurance, on 2006 Audi A6 would be higher. At 3,130 cc, 2006 Audi A6 is equipped with a bigger engine. In terms of performance, 2006 Audi A6 (343 HP @ 6500 RPM) has 239 more horse power than 2008 Honda HR-V. (104 HP @ 6200 RPM). In normal driving conditions, 2006 Audi A6 should accelerate faster than 2008 Honda HR-V. With that said, vehicle weight also plays an important factor in acceleration. 2006 Audi A6 weights approximately 560 kg more than 2008 Honda HR-V. So despite on having greater horse power, its additional weight may have an impact towards its acceleration in comparison.
Because 2006 Audi A6 is four wheel drive (4WD), it will have significant more traction and grip than 2008 Honda HR-V. In wet, icy, snow, or gravel driving conditions, 2006 Audi A6 will offer significantly more control. With that said, do keep in mind that many other factors such as speed and the wear on your tires can also have significant impact on traction and control. Let's talk about torque, 2006 Audi A6 (243 Nm @ 3250 RPM) has 107 more torque (in Nm) than 2008 Honda HR-V. (136 Nm @ 3500 RPM). This means 2006 Audi A6 will have an easier job in driving up hills or pulling heavy equipment than 2008 Honda HR-V.
Compare all specifications:
2006 Audi A6 | 2008 Honda HR-V | |
Make | Audi | Honda |
Model | A6 | HR-V |
Year Released | 2006 | 2008 |
Engine Position | Front | Front |
Engine Size | 3130 cc | 1590 cc |
Horse Power | 343 HP | 104 HP |
Engine RPM | 6500 RPM | 6200 RPM |
Torque | 243 Nm | 136 Nm |
Torque RPM | 3250 RPM | 3500 RPM |
Top Speed | 209 km/hour | 165 km/hour |
Acceleration 0-100mph | 7.3 seconds | 11.2 seconds |
Drive Type | 4WD | Front |
Transmission Type | Manual | Manual |
Number of Seats | 5 seats | 4 seats |
Number of Doors | 5 doors | 5 doors |
Vehicle Weight | 1740 kg | 1180 kg |
Vehicle Length | 4940 mm | 4020 mm |
Vehicle Width | 1860 mm | 1700 mm |
Vehicle Height | 1470 mm | 1590 mm |
Wheelbase Size | 2850 mm | 2360 mm |
Fuel Consumption Overall | 10.9 L/100km | 8.2 L/100km |
Fuel Tank Capacity | 70 L | 55 L |
